The Allure of Anagrams and Word Games
The process of unscrambling words like “Lywole” falls under the umbrella of anagrams. An anagram is a word or phrase formed by rearranging the letters of a different word or phrase, typically using all the original letters exactly once. These puzzles tap into our innate desire for problem-solving, creativity, and linguistic exploration. The cognitive benefits are undeniable – anagrams stimulate the brain, sharpening memory, enhancing vocabulary, and promoting critical thinking skills.
Why are these types of puzzles so popular? Part of the appeal lies in their accessibility. You don’t need specialized knowledge or equipment to enjoy them. All you need is a set of letters and a curious mind. Word games offer a delightful escape from the everyday, a mental workout disguised as entertainment. They can be enjoyed solo, providing a quiet moment of reflection and challenge, or with friends and family, fostering social interaction and friendly competition.
Beyond simple anagrams, there are many other word games that involve the skill of unscrambling. Scrabble, for example, requires players to create words from a set of letter tiles, strategically placing them on a board for points. Boggle challenges players to find as many words as possible within a grid of jumbled letters within a time limit. Crossword puzzles present clues that lead to the discovery of hidden words, often requiring a combination of vocabulary, knowledge, and deductive reasoning. These games, and countless others like them, contribute to the enduring popularity of wordplay. They are enjoyed by people of all ages and backgrounds, and their ability to entertain, educate, and challenge continues to captivate audiences worldwide.
